WebAug 24, 2024 · Wikimedia Commons Hearing aids that fully sit in the ear canal require a custom-fit earmold. A hearing aid fitting can take as little as 15 minutes or up to two hours. Your fitting will take longer if it includes a hearing test, real ear measurements, and a thorough introduction to using your hearing aid.

WebMar 13, 2024 · If you look at your right (red) side, you’ll see that between the 750 to the 2.3kish range, you’re actually out of fitting range. On your left (blue) side, you’re justinside. In most cases, audiologists have to determine and weigh whether or not you should get both closed domes, or both vented domes, but with a different receiver.
